Story

Isaac has decided to take on the challenge of swimming a mile, to raise money for his friend Chester. Both boys were born in 2016, but

Chester was born 9 weeks early and spent his first 50 days in a Neonatal Intensive Care Unit; Chester was later diagnosed with Quadriplegic Cerebral Palsy affecting all 4 limbs meaning his gross motor functions are severely impacted and he is a full time wheelchair user.

In 2021, Chester and his family travelled to the US during lockdown for highly complex SDR surgery which his parents fully fundraised for.

The procedure was a success. Through Chester’s and his family’s gritty determination he has achieved so much, however, his parents have had to continue to pay for multiple weekly therapy sessions as part of Chester's ongoing rehabilitation post op. He has made fantastic progress but as he grows and his body changes, he has to work even harder and physical therapy is more important than ever. This is why they are continuing to fundraise for his ongoing rehabilitation and to ensure he has the best quality of life possible

Isaac has been inspired by how much Chester has achieved in life and that is why he has chosen Chester’s charity to raise money for. when he takes on the challenge of swimming a mile.
